Read the given statement(s) and conclusions carefully.
Assuming that the information given in the statement(s) is true, even if it appears to be at variance with commonly known facts, decide which of the given conclusions logically follow(s) from the statement(s). Statements: Some legs are hands. No hand is an arm. Conclusions: (I) Some legs are arms. (II) Some hands are legs.Solution
Some legs are hands (I) + No hand is an arm (E) β Some legs are not arms (I). Hence conclusion I does not follow. Some legs are hands (I) β Conversion β Some hands are legs (I). Hence conclusion II follows.
